Understanding Sewage Backup: A Serious Problem in Everett Homes

Sewage backups occur when there’s a blockage or failure in the home’s plumbing system, leading to the reversal of wastewater flow. This can result from various factors, including tree root intrusion, faulty pipes, heavy rainfall, or nearby construction activities. When raw sewage spills into your home, it brings with it not only unpleasant odors but also harmful bacteria, viruses, and parasites that can cause serious illnesses.

Sanitation and Health Hazards

Raw sewage contains a wide range of pathogens capable of causing diseases such as gastroenteritis, hepatitis A, and typhoid fever. In addition to these health risks, the toxic gases released by decaying organic matter in sewage can lead to respiratory issues or even death in severe cases. Prompt cleanup is essential to minimize these dangers and prevent long-term damage to your property and family’s well-being.

The Sewage Backup Cleanup Process in Everett

Once you’ve selected a reliable cleanup company, they will follow a structured process to restore your home to its pre-backup condition:

1. Initial Assessment

The technicians will conduct a thorough inspection of the affected areas, documenting the extent of damage and identifying potential sources of the backup. They’ll also assess any structural integrity issues that may require repair or replacement.

2. Containment and Isolation

To prevent further contamination, they will contain and isolate the damaged areas using barriers and plastic sheeting. This step is crucial for minimizing the spread of bacteria and pathogens to other parts of your home.

3. Sewage Removal

Using specialized equipment, the cleanup team will remove all visible signs of sewage from floors, walls, furnishings, and other affected surfaces. They use powerful vacuums to suck out the water and debris, ensuring no residue remains.

4. Deodorization and Sanitation

After removing the physical evidence of sewage, technicians apply powerful deodorizers and sanitizing agents to eliminate odors and kill any remaining pathogens. This step ensures a safe and hygienic environment for your family.

5. Drying and Humidity Control

To prevent mold growth and additional water damage, they employ high-capacity dehumidifiers to reduce humidity levels in the affected areas. Proper drying is essential for structural integrity and prevents costly repairs down the line.

6. Repairs and Restoration

Once everything is dry and safe, the cleanup company will work with you or your insurance provider to facilitate any necessary repairs or replacements, including drywall, flooring, and plumbing issues.

Q: How can I prevent future sewage backups?

A: Regular maintenance of your plumbing system is key to preventing sewage backups. Schedule routine inspections and cleaning by professional plumbers, avoid pouring grease down the drain, and use drain covers to catch hair and other debris. Additionally, ensure tree roots near pipes are managed to prevent obstructions.
